Private clinics may claim to offer quick ADHD assessments However, they are usually unreliable. In reality, they do not adhere to national guidelines, and may give patients a wrong diagnosis. BBC Panorama's investigation revealed this. The report revealed that three private clinics diagnosed an undercover journalist via video calls, despite the fact that an even more thorough NHS assessment showed the patient did not suffer from ADHD. In addition to assessing your symptoms, the psychiatrist will also examine other factors that could influence your condition, including co-morbid conditions. These assessments may take up to 2 sessions to complete. The assessment will include an interview with a clinician and rating scales. The psychiatrist will discuss your symptoms and how they affect your daily life. It can be a challenge to explain, which is why it's helpful to bring a family member for extra support.

Some clinicians are too quick to grab the pen and write a prescription without conducting a comprehensive evaluation. This type of "drive through" evaluation is more prone to produce an inaccurate diagnosis. If a doctor wants to prescribe ADHD medication for children, they should review the teacher rating scales that have been completed and interview educators as part an interview in a clinical setting. This takes time and effort, but it's essential for a proper diagnosis.

Some private clinics have been accused of providing inaccurate assessments of adults with ADHD. Panorama, a BBC investigation, spoke with dozens of patients who claimed that private clinics were speeding through assessments or not following guidelines. This has led many cases of people being incorrectly diagnosed as ADHD and being prescribed powerful drugs, without a thorough NHS assessment.
